1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ear vs. 1996 Volvo S40
To start off, 1996 Volvo S40 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ear would be higher. At 2,477 cc (4 cylinders), 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1996 Volvo S40 (104 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 6 more horse power than 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ear. (98 HP @ 4200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1996 Volvo S40 should accelerate faster than 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ear weights approximately 426 kg more than 1996 Volvo S40.
Let's talk about torque, 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ear (240 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 97 more torque (in Nm) than 1996 Volvo S40. (143 Nm @ 4200 RPM). This means 1995 Mitsubishi Delica Space Gear will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1996 Volvo S40.
